Ordinals
beta
Address 3622J5LjRMyA37PUQ6NZEfgjJHY3B8uznT
sat balance
4276
runes balances
outputs
1d0e7a6d784c62b4a31d3c3f196221e23404f4b56cad2f23617a5030563f4356:1